The bellybutton is the scar left over from your umbilical cord. For some reason, it doesn't always heal the same way. Some becomes innies and some become outies.

You may have a boil or pimple deep in the bellybutton. They will break open on their own and discharge puss/blood and mucus. Try using a Q-tip to clean out the area, put a drop of hydrogen peroxide in the bellybutton to help clean it. If the condition persists then see your doctor as it may be an ongoing infection that will require medication or further investigation.

Sure it can. It's skin after all, connected to the same blood supply as all other skin. If you tear it, scratch it too hard or something, it'll bleed. A far rarer reason would be that one of the blood vessels in the umbilical cord didn't close properly.

the bellybutton doesn't pop out during pregnancy it just appears to. The skin on your stomach gets stretched tight across your pregnancy bump so there is no hole for the bellybutton.
